Skin sensitisation

Endpoint conclusion
Additional information:

The data requirement is waived due to the classification of the substance as corrosive (R35) and the severity of the skin reactions seen in the acute dermal toxicity study and the dermal irritation study. Dermal exposure to phosphorus trichloride will be dominated by local irritation and skin sensitisation is considered to be unlikely.

Respiratory sensitisation

Endpoint conclusion
Additional information:

No information is available. Inhalation exposure to phosphorus trichloride will be dominated by local irritation and skin sensitisation is considered to be unlikely. Case reports of occupational asthma are available are published, but it is unclear whether these have an immunological basis or simply represent an irritant effect.

Justification for classification or non-classification

No classification is proposed in the absence of any experimental studies or relevant findings from human exposure.
